Is GoPro’s New Insurance Plan Worth It?

GoPro Care covers you for two years

Raise your hand if you鈥檝e ever broken your action camera. Personally, I鈥檝e cracked lenses in mountain bike crashes and I鈥檝e had them leak in the ocean. The problems is that we use these expensive little things precisely when we鈥檙e engaged in our riskiest behaviors. Wouldn鈥檛 it be nice to have an insurance policy for them? Well, now you can.聽For GoPros anyway.

GoPro just announced its first insurance plan: . Sound familiar? Maybe a little like Apple Care? Yeah, well, it works basically the same way. You pay $100 for the Black,聽$80 for Silver, and $40 for the Session.* You have to get the coverage聽within the first 60 days of buying your camera, then聽you鈥檙e covered for two years. Scratch a lens, mic stops working, the whole thing is frozen and won鈥檛 start for some mysterious reason? You鈥檙e covered.聽

Also, as with Apple Care, GoPro Care comes with a direct line to customer service. So if you can鈥檛 figure how to pair your camera with your phone, you can have someone talk you through it. GoPro also claims that they can help with tips and trick, should you so desire. For example, 鈥淚鈥檓 going wakeboarding. Which settings would you use and why?鈥 and they鈥檒l say 鈥1080p super view at 60fps because it鈥檒l squeeze more into the frame and you鈥檒l be able to slow it down 50 percent and still keep it smooth. Also, you probably want the wrist strap mount鈥” etc.聽

The question must be asked, though, is two years of coverage worth up to 100 bucks? Maybe not聽if you have the Hero4 Session, which聽only costs $200. But聽If you have the Hero4 Silver or Black, however, which cost $400 and $500 respectively, then yeah, I think it would be worth it, assuming you actually take your cameras out of the house and do things with them. And holy crap, when GoPro鈥檚 drone comes out later this year it will mostly definitely be worth insuring: drones were practically made to be crashed.聽

Cool to see this as an option. The next time I buy a GoPro (Hero5? Later this year, please?) I鈥檒l definitely make sure it鈥檚 covered. It's nice to have one less thing to worry about when you鈥檙e out there doing something stupid and dangerous.
